Do Spiders Go To The Toilet. Since most household spiders are perfectly harmless, it’s best not to flush them down the toilet because it is actually an inhumane thing to do. When you wash the spider down the drain, it will be trapped underwater and eventually drown. This can differ however depending on the type of spider involved, as some spiders can survive for as long as an hour without oxygen, meaning they may simply end up on the other end of the sewer system.
